The Association of Tennis Professionals (ATP) Challenger Tour, in 2018 is the secondary professional tennis circuit organized by the ATP. The 2018 ATP Challenger Tour calendar comprises 62 tournaments (as of May), with prize money ranging from $50,000 up to $150,000. It is the 42nd edition of challenger tournaments cycle, and 10th under the name of Challenger Tour.
